WebWhat size purlin should I use? As per generals rule and guideline, you need a 4- inch (100mm) purlin for 3m span, 6- inch (150mm) purlin for 4m & 5m span, 8- inch (200mm) purlin for 6m & 10- inch (250mm) purlin for 8m span which can safely transfer the load to trusses. Web30 mrt. 2024 · C-shaped steel purlins are divided into five specifications: 80, 100, 120, 140 and 160 according to different heights. The length can be determined according to the engineering design, but considering the conditions such as transportation and installation, the total length is generally no more than 12m. WebA 100mm C purlin can allow span upto 3.5m to 4.7m far distance when spaced @1200mm C/C and wind velocity @33 m/s. A 150mm C purlin can allow span upto 5.5m to 8.7m far distance when spaced @1200mm C/C and wind velocity @33 m/s. What is the standard purlin range for bolts?
